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 35
  2. Stir together pecans, brown sugar, and cream.
  3. Spread in a single layer in a lightly buttered 9-inch round cake pan.
  4. Bake 20 minutes or until sugar is slightly crystallized, stirring once. Cool in pan 10 minutes; finely chop.
  5. Spread mixture in a single layer on wax paper.
  6. Place chocolate in a microwave-safe measuring cup. Microwave at HIGH 1 minute or until melted, stirring every 15 seconds. Immediately dip two-thirds of each pretzel rod into chocolate, twirling to coat all sides.
  7. Roll coated ends of pretzels in pecan mixture. Gently place on wax paper; let stand until chocolate is set. Store in airtight containers 4 days.
